Why Medical Billing And Coding Programs Matter in Revenue Integrity

Medical billing and coding programs ensure accurate clinical documentation and optimal reimbursement cycles for healthcare providers. These systems represent the foundation of financial health, directly impacting the revenue integrity of hospitals and private practices.

Without robust coding accuracy, organizations face significant revenue leakage and increased audit risks. Implementing professional-grade billing software and rigorous training programs bridges the gap between patient care delivery and sustainable fiscal performance, turning administrative complexity into a predictable revenue stream for healthcare leaders.

Enhancing Revenue Integrity Through Advanced Coding Accuracy

Revenue integrity depends on the precise translation of clinical services into billable codes. High-quality medical billing and coding programs eliminate common errors that trigger claim denials and payment delays.

Key pillars include standardized documentation workflows, automated charge capture, and continuous staff training on evolving regulatory standards. For CFOs, these components reduce administrative overhead and accelerate cash flow velocity by ensuring cleaner claims reach payers the first time. The financial impact is profound, as precise coding minimizes write-offs and maximizes reimbursement rates across all service lines.

Practical implementation requires integrating computer-assisted coding tools directly with your Electronic Health Record system to automate manual entry tasks while maintaining rigorous oversight of clinical data quality.

Strategic Impact of Automated Billing Programs

Automation transforms traditional billing from a reactive task into a proactive financial management tool. By utilizing medical billing and coding programs supported by artificial intelligence, organizations can identify patterns in claim denials and rectify systemic issues before they impact the bottom line.

Effective automation focuses on real-time eligibility verification, automated claim scrubbing, and predictive analytics for revenue cycle management. These systems allow administrators to monitor key performance indicators with greater visibility, enabling data-driven decisions that enhance long-term financial stability. Modern practices must view billing automation not merely as an IT project, but as a critical lever for enterprise growth.

Deploying intelligent automation requires a phased approach that starts with high-volume, low-complexity claims to build internal confidence before scaling to more complex surgical or diagnostic procedures.

Key Challenges

Healthcare organizations often struggle with fragmented data systems and a shortage of specialized coding staff. High staff turnover rates and frequent updates to payer reimbursement policies further complicate the billing environment.

Best Practices

Prioritize regular audits to identify recurring coding errors and foster interdisciplinary communication between clinical and billing departments. Investing in scalable software solutions that adapt to regulatory changes ensures long-term operational success.

Governance Alignment

Strong governance frameworks ensure that billing processes comply with HIPAA and evolving healthcare mandates. Aligning technology deployment with corporate compliance strategies mitigates litigation risks while protecting institutional reputation.

Q: How do billing programs improve audit readiness?

A: These programs maintain detailed, time-stamped digital trails of every coding action taken on a claim. This level of transparency simplifies internal audits and prepares organizations for external regulatory inquiries.

Q: Can small physician practices benefit from automation?

A: Absolutely, automation reduces the heavy administrative burden on small teams by handling repetitive tasks like status checks and claim scrubbing. It allows practitioners to focus more on patient outcomes rather than manual billing processes.

Q: What role does data governance play in billing?

A: Robust data governance ensures that all clinical and billing data remains secure, accurate, and compliant with evolving healthcare regulations. It acts as the necessary oversight layer to prevent fraudulent activities and data breaches.
